Eastside Elementary is a high-poverty, mid-sized elementary school in Lancaster, California, enrolling 423 students.
Class loads run heavy: 28.2:1 is larger than about 93% of California schools and 31% above the 21.5:1 state mean, so each teacher carries more students than is typical.
Economic need is high: 85.3% of students qualify for free meals, 54% above the California average, a Title I-weighted population that federal funding formulas prioritise.
With 423 students, its enrollment sits close to the California median campus size.
Its Resource Investment Index trails 96% of the 9,998 California schools with a score on record, one of the lower results on this measure.
Among 1,688 similarly sized, similarly resourced-need California schools statewide, it ranks #1,579, in the lower tier once campus size and economic need are matched.
Its student body is led by Hispanic or Latino (78%) and African American (11%) (diversity index 37/100).
Counselor access is stretched at roughly 423 students per counselor, well above the ASCA-recommended 250:1 ceiling.
Chronic absenteeism is elevated: 42.6% of students missed 10% or more of school days (2021-22 Civil Rights Data Collection).
Its district draws 17.5% of revenue from federal sources, an above-typical federal share that tends to track a higher-need student population.
